Ven Foundation
Vivienne Emma-Nwakanma (VEN) Foundation is a non-governmental organization which was registered with Nigeria Corporate Affairs Commission in 2007. Her major areas of focus are to provide free medical services to all the indigenes of Achalla and its surrounding environs, encourage educational excellence and foster spiritual development in the community.
Our major areas of focus are providing free medical services to all indigenes of Achalla and its environs, providing educational grants to the youth of Achalla, in Awka North Local government and encouraging the growth of a spirit filled and loving community.
Our Mission
To create an avenue for all the indigenes of Achalla to have access to good medical care, quality education and spiritual growth.
Our Vision
Bringing sustainable development to Achalla and its environs
Message from the Founder
Thank you for taking out time to check on VEN foundation. We are so excited about starting this mission with the primary aim of bridging the gap in literacy especially illiteracy(and improving medical aid in Achalla community. The community has suffered uncontrolled death mortality and an astronomical increase in illiteracy especially male illiteracy. We had to swing into action by creating VEN Foundation to restore hope, inspire an atmosphere of healing and health to people, and ultimately mitigate uncontrollable death rate in Achalla and its environs.
VEN foundation was created with the objective to reach out to rural people, especially Achalla (Awka North Local Government of Anambra State, Nigeria) indigenes, who are largely in the greatest of needs and suffering untold hardship.
VEN foundation is focused on helping the less privileged in Achalla town. These are people who, through no fault of theirs, have lost every hope of survival. The foundation is driven by the belief that human beings have the capacity to realize their full potential if given the opportunity.
Through education, we empower young men in our community to make positive life choices that would enable them to maximize their potential and live a good life in the future. We help these youths to develop critical and creative thinking skills to become more confident and to play active roles in community development.
It has been a great privilege to be closely involved in the formation of this unique organization, and I give God all the Glory. My ultimate goal is to change the narrative of the less fortunate, restore their dignity, and open up vistas of opportunities for excellent medical care in Achalla community. We desire the holistic transformation of indigenes of Achalla and to meet the medical, social, psychological, psychiatric, educational, spiritual, financial, recreational needs, and above all receive LOVE.
We are eternally grateful for the support we have received from many individuals and people that make our work possible. We always welcome support, suggestions and advice offered in any way.
